Briefing

Current centralized platforms for AI prompts lack mechanisms for proper attribution, quality assurance, and fair compensation, rendering these critical inputs ephemeral. PromptChain introduces a novel Web3 architecture that formalizes AI prompts as verifiable digital assets through the strategic integration of IPFS for immutable storage, smart contracts for decentralized governance, and tokenized incentives for community curation. This foundational breakthrough establishes an open, censorship-resistant ecosystem for human-AI collaboration, ensuring true ownership and monetization of AI prompts, thereby unlocking new paradigms for intellectual property in the age of generative AI.

Context

Before this research, AI prompts were largely treated as transient inputs within proprietary systems, lacking the formal digital asset status, immutable provenance, and decentralized governance structures that underpin value creation in Web3. This prevailing theoretical limitation restricted creator rights, hindered open innovation, and prevented the development of a transparent, equitable marketplace for these increasingly valuable intellectual contributions.

Analysis

PromptChain’s core mechanism redefines AI prompts as first-class digital assets. The system employs a layered architecture → an IPFS-based storage layer ensures content-addressed, immutable storage for prompt data, while a blockchain layer, driven by smart contracts, manages verifiable ownership, robust version control, and a rich metadata schema. A stake-weighted validation mechanism and a token economy are integral, incentivizing community curation and rewarding contributors proportionally to their impact. This approach fundamentally differs from previous centralized models that retain control and value within platform silos, establishing a truly decentralized and transparent framework.

Outlook

This research paves the way for a robust, decentralized marketplace for AI prompts, enabling creators to monetize their intellectual contributions directly. In the next 3-5 years, this framework could unlock novel applications in AI-driven content creation, personalized learning, and autonomous agent development, where verifiable, high-quality prompts are critical inputs. Future research will likely focus on integrating advanced cryptographic primitives for prompt privacy and developing more sophisticated economic models for dynamic valuation within these emerging ecosystems.

PromptChain fundamentally redefines AI prompts as verifiable, ownable digital assets, establishing a critical new primitive for decentralized AI ecosystems and intellectual property management.
